What is Auto Multiple Choice?

Auto Multiple Choice (AMC) is an open-source software designed for creating, printing,

scanning, and automatically grading multiple-choice questionnaires. Unlike proprietary

systems, AMC offers flexibility and customization, allowing educators to design tests with

various question formats and answer sheets tailored to specific requirements. The

software leverages optical mark recognition technology to read scanned answer sheets,

minimizing human error and significantly speeding up the grading process.

Step 1: Designing the Questionnaire

Using AMC’s intuitive interface, educators or administrators create multiple-choice

questionnaires. The software supports various question types, including single correct

answers, multiple correct answers, and even questions with weighted scoring. Users can

then generate answer sheets compatible with OMR scanning devices or standard

scanners.

Step 2: Distributing and Collecting Answer Sheets

Once printed, these answer sheets are distributed to test-takers, who mark their

responses by filling in bubbles or boxes. After completion, the sheets are collected and

prepared for scanning.

Step 3: Scanning and Data Processing

Here’s where the automation shines. The scanned answer sheets are uploaded into the

AMC system, often through the Welcome GNA platform’s interface. AMC’s OMR technology

reads the marks, detects any anomalies (like multiple answers where only one is allowed),

and compiles the data.

Step 4: Automatic Grading and Feedback

After processing, AMC automatically grades the tests based on pre-defined answer keys.

The system can generate detailed reports, including individual scores, statistics on

question difficulty, and overall class performance. Welcome GNA enhances this

experience by providing an accessible dashboard where educators can review results,

export data, or even provide feedback directly to learners.

Question

Answer

What is Auto Multiple

Choice (AMC)?

Auto Multiple Choice (AMC) is an open-source software

designed to create and correct multiple-choice exams

automatically using scanned answer sheets.

How does Auto Multiple

Choice work?

AMC works by generating multiple-choice exam papers

and corresponding answer sheets, which are then

scanned after the exam. The software processes the

scanned sheets to automatically grade the students'

answers.

Is Auto Multiple Choice free

to use?

Yes, Auto Multiple Choice is free and open-source

software released under the GNU General Public License

(GPL).

Which operating systems

support Auto Multiple

Choice?

Auto Multiple Choice primarily supports GNU/Linux

operating systems, but it can also be installed and used

on Windows and macOS with some configuration.

Can Auto Multiple Choice

handle different languages?

Yes, Auto Multiple Choice supports multiple languages,

allowing educators to create exams in various languages

to accommodate diverse student populations.

What file formats does Auto

Multiple Choice use?

Auto Multiple Choice uses LaTeX for generating exam

papers and PDFs for the output documents. It also

processes scanned images in formats like TIFF or JPEG for

grading.

How accurate is Auto

Multiple Choice in grading

exams?

Auto Multiple Choice is highly accurate in grading

multiple-choice exams, provided that the scanned answer

sheets are clear and properly aligned during scanning.
